I first heard the words "deep learning" in 2010 on a midnight run around Stanford's Lake Lagunita. My running partner told me about the budding technique that promised to allow machines to learn like human brains. Rather than focusing on more classical statistical models, we could take a very simple function and stack thousands, then millions, then billions, and now trillions of these "neurons" to learn and make decisions.
